The original TV series 'Roots' arrived…

The original TV series 'Roots' arrived in a nice compact plastic box & all 3 disks look in perfect condition. The reason I'm rating you just 3 stars is because the disks won't play on my blue ray player.Although clearly aimed for the European market, they must use another format. Have decided to keep the disks, because have discovered that there are a number of multi format blue ray players now on the market. To my knowledge you did not tell potential customers of this likely problem which is a mistake.
